Error: Expected '}' before 'else' in C

Error: Expected '}' before 'else' occurs, if closing scope curly brace of if statement is missing.

Consider the code:

#include <stdio.h>

int main() 
{
	int a = 10;
	
	if(a == 10)
	{
		printf("Yes!\n");
	else
	{
		printf("No!\n");
	}
	
	return 0;
}

Output

prog.cpp: In function ‘int main()’:
prog.cpp:10:2: error: expected ‘}’ before ‘else’
  else
  ^~~~

How to fix?

See the code, closing curly brace } is missing before else statement. To fix this error - close the if statement's scope properly.

Correct code:

#include <stdio.h>

int main() 
{
	int a = 10;
	
	if(a == 10)
	{
		printf("Yes!\n");
	}		
	else
	{
		printf("No!\n");
	}
	
	return 0;
}

Output

Yes!
